利用监控量测数据,结合灰色理论建立隧道洞身位移变形系统。采用尖点突变分析方法,对开挖过程中初支结构的稳定性进行分析,建立隧道塌方预测模型。通过杜家山隧道发生的塌方事故与预测模型进行验证,得出塌方预测结果与实际情况相吻合;说明建立的隧道塌方预测模型是有效的,可以用来指导该类隧道的施工。
Based on the monitoring measured data and combined with grey theory, tunnel hole body displacement deformation system was established. The analysis was made on the stability of temporary supporting structure for excavation with cusp catastrophe method to build prediction model of tunnel collapse. The practical case of collapsing accident in Dujiashan tunnel showed the same result with that of prediction.
